Select Location

S.A.Auto Care

Autocare

Anna Nagar, Chengalpattu

. Store Timings

Directions

Searches leading to this page

Other in Anna Nagar, Chengalpattu Other in Chengalpattu in Anna Nagar, Chengalpattu in Anna Nagar, Chengalpattu S.A.Auto Care, Anna Nagar S.A.Auto Care, Anna Nagar Deals S.A.Auto Care, Anna Nagar, Chengalpattu